The folks over at the Car Blog have posted a link the some friendly driving advice, which we here at VB hope you take to heart this holiday. A few items of note:
- Always signal your intentions in advance. Use turn signals.
- When traveling long distances, take frequent breaks and rotate drivers to reduce fatigue.
- In the event of a minor accident, involved drivers should immediately drive their vehicles to a safe place, out of the flow of traffic.
- (And I’ll add) If you’re drinking, have a designated driver. If for no other reason, just think of the increased law enforcement on the road today (trust me, they’re everywhere). Injuring someone or spendng time in jail is a crappy way to spend your 4th.
